Output 8323c541ed3baced90e9a8387d5b249f3b96a72b332989469c730cf34426fae5:0

value
31217659
script pubkey
OP_0 OP_PUSHBYTES_20 efd106c4ac30ac67022ca82cd2c2d3b7a8b9702d
address
bc1qalgsd39vxzkxwq3v4qkd9sknk75tjupdqde508
transaction
8323c541ed3baced90e9a8387d5b249f3b96a72b332989469c730cf34426fae5
confirmations
356782
spent
true